i think the compression killed it. the fact that you were at f2.8 @1/60 second tells me you were handheld. the ISO 1600 was a little much, i would have placed the camera on a car or something stable and tried for a longer exposure.
this photo does not do your 20D justice. please do not take this personnally but i've seen better photos out of my sisters cameraphone.
the depth of feel is too shallow,and is not bringing out anything important.
